Appropriate Preposition:

  • Angry at ( রাগান্বিত (কারো আচরণ) ) I am angry at your conduct.
  • Differ from ( ভিন্নরূপ হওয়া ) This thing differs from that.
  • Trust with ( বিশ্বাস করা (জিনিস) ) You may trust me with the work.
  • Eligible for ( যোগ্য ) He is eligible for the post.
  • Due to ( কারণে ) His absence is due to illness.
  • Taste for ( রুচি ) She has no taste for music.

Idioms:

  • By no means ( কোন ভাবেই না ) I shall by no means call on him.
  • Steer clear of ( এড়াইয়া চলা ) You must steer clear of evil company.
  • Take one to task ( তিরস্কার করা ) He was taken to task for negligence of duty.
  • Bid fair ( ভালো কিছু আশা করা ) He bids fair to be a good doctor.
  • slap on the wrist ( মৃদু শাস্তি ) Although he broke the rules, he was only given a slap on the wrist
